Webcorrect verb [ T ] uk / kəˈrekt / us / kəˈrekt / B2 to show or tell someone that something is wrong and to make it right: Students said it was helpful if the teacher corrected their … WebBoth ‘people who’ and ‘people that’ are grammatically correct. Using ‘that’ is correct when referring to people or objects. Using ‘who,’ on the other hand, is correct specifically when referring to people only. Particular contexts may call for ‘who’ while some contexts may prefer the use of ‘that.’ tremors headphones
